The Evolution of Automatic Downspout Steel Square and Round Pipe Machines
In the modern manufacturing landscape, efficiency and precision are paramount
. One of the most innovative advancements in this field is the development of automatic downspout steel square and round pipe machines. These machines are designed to streamline the production of various types of pipes used in drainage systems, ensuring durability and effectiveness in managing rainwater.Traditionally, the manufacturing of downspouts and pipes involved labor-intensive processes that required significant manual intervention. Operators would cut, shape, and assemble various components, often leading to inconsistencies in quality and dimension. However, the introduction of automatic machines has revolutionized this process. Today’s automatic machines utilize advanced technologies such as computer numerical control (CNC) and robotics to automate the entire workflow, from raw material input to finished product output.
One of the key benefits of these machines is their ability to produce both square and round pipes with high precision. The use of high-quality steel ensures that the pipes are not only rugged and long-lasting but also resistant to corrosion and environmental factors. Automated systems can achieve tight tolerances and uniform dimensions, which are critical for effective drainage systems. This precision reduces the risk of leaks and ensures that installations function as intended.
Moreover, the versatility of automatic downspout steel machines means they can easily switch between different types of products based on market demand. Manufacturers can quickly adjust the settings and tools needed to produce various configurations of pipes, making the production process more flexible and responsive to customer needs. This adaptability is particularly beneficial in today’s fast-paced market, where consumer preferences can shift rapidly.
Energy efficiency is another significant advantage of these machines. Modern equipment is designed to optimize power consumption throughout the manufacturing process. By minimizing waste and maximizing output, companies can not only reduce their operational costs but also contribute to more sustainable production practices.
Furthermore, the integration of smart technology into these machines enables real-time monitoring and diagnostics. Manufacturers can track the performance of their machines, predict maintenance needs, and ultimately reduce downtime. This leads to increased overall productivity and profitability.
